Source of fever/cough treatment: Health center (public) (Niger) (C_FEVTRNE4)

Data file: NER2006-C.dat

Questions and instructions

Literal question
471. Where did you seek advice or treatment?
Where else?

RECORD EVERYTHING MENTIONED.

PUBLIC SECTOR

HOSPITAL A
HEALTH CENTER B
MATERNITY C
FAMILY HEALTH CENTER D
HEALTH HUT E
OTHER PUBLIC (SPECIFY) __________ F

PRIVATE SECTOR

PRIVATE HOSPITAL/CLINIC G
DOCTOR'S OFFICE H
PHARMACY I
WALKING SALESMAN J
OTHER PRIVATE (SPECIFY) __________ K

OTHER SOURCE

SHOP L
TRADITIONAL HEALER M
OTHER (SPECIFY) __________ X

Description

Definition
For young children with a fever or cough in the past 2 weeks, FEVTRNE4 indicates, in response to an open-ended question, whether the child received treatment at a government health center for this illness. This response category is country-specific to Niger.

Some samples in the "FEVTR" series include categories that can be consolidated into a single response. IPUMS-DHS uses supplemental programming to combine these responses in a standard variable while preserving the separate responses in country-specific variables.

FEVTRNE4 is combined with FEVTRNE5 (maternal and child health center) in FEVTRPUBHC (all public health centers) for the 1992 Niger sample.

Additionally, FEVTRNE4 is combined with FEVTRNE8 (family health center) in FEVTRPUBHC for the 2006 Niger sample.

IPUMS-DHS users interested in using FEVTRNE4 are encouraged to review FEVTRPUBHC for a more comprehensive response category.
